Item 5.02 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.

(b)

On June 1, 2018, Mr. Stephen Haggerty’s employment relationship with Hyatt Hotels Corporation (the “Company”) terminated.

(e)

On May 31, 2018 (the “Effective Date”), the Company entered into an Advisory Agreement with Mr. Haggerty through his limited liability company, Bare Hill Advisory LLC (the “Advisory Agreement”). Under the Advisory Agreement, the Company will pay Mr. Haggerty a monthly retainer of $75,000 for each of June and July, 2018 and $15,000 for each calendar month of continued services thereafter. If the Company terminates the agreement prior to August 1, 2018 (other than due to Mr. Haggerty’s breach), Mr. Haggerty will be entitled to payment of 80% of his fees for the period through July 31, 2018. In addition, Mr. Haggerty will be eligible to receive discretionary cash success bonuses linked to the successful completion of certain projects.

The foregoing description of the Advisory Agreement is qualified in its entirety by reference to the text of the Advisory Agreement, a copy of which is attached hereto as Exhibit 10.1 and incorporated herein by reference.
